How much do distribution associ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for distribution associate in Henrico, VA is $16.50,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.18 and $18.75 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a distribution associate?

A distribution associate works in a warehouse or product distribution facility. As a distribution associate, your job duties are to receive customer orders, locate purchased items, and pack them for shipment. A career as a distribution associate does not require you to have formal education or qualifications, nor is previous experience necessary, though it may be helpful. You should have strong multitasking and organizational skills, as you deal with multiple customer orders simultaneously and may be required to find and restock items without looking through item location databases.

What are some common challenges faced by distribution associates, and how can new hires effectively overcome them?

Distribution Associates often face challenges such as maintaining accuracy under tight deadlines, adapting to rapidly changing inventory systems, and working efficiently within a fast-paced, team-oriented environment. New hires can overcome these obstacles by staying organized, being proactive in communicating with supervisors and colleagues, and taking advantage of training resources provided by the employer. Developing a strong attention to detail and a willingness to learn new technology or processes can also enhance performance and job satisfaction in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a distribution associ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Distribution Associate, you typically need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with inventory management systems, handheld scanners, and warehouse management software is often required. Dependability, teamwork, and effective communication are vital soft skills for excelling in this role. These abilities ensure efficient, accurate handling and movement of goods, supporting smooth operations and customer satisfaction in the supply chain.

The main difference between a Distribution Associate and a Warehouse Worker lies in their specific roles. Distribution Associates typically focus on order picking, packing, and preparing shipments for delivery, often working closely with logistics systems. Warehouse Workers may perform broader tasks such as inventory management, stocking, and general warehouse maintenance. Both roles require similar credentials and work environments, but Distribution Associates usually have more specialized responsibilities related to distribution processes.

Job Summary

With input and mentoring from Supervisor and Forestry Coordinators, this role coordinates forestry and right-of-way maintenance activities to ensure reliable operation of distribution lines within their assigned area and throughout the system. Conducts field inspections of forestry contractors, who maintain clearances between vegetation and electrical conductors, to ensure work is completed on schedule and according to company specifications. Conducts field observations and provides feedback to Forestry Supervisor and contractors. Investigates tree-related outages to determine root cause. Works with Supervisor-Electric Distribution Forestry to develop and implement action plans to prevent future outages. Schedules and coordinates right-of-way clearing for new construction projects. Monitors operational costs and performance of forestry contractors who perform unit bid mileage work, time and material tree and brush control work activities, as well as herbicide applications. Makes recommendations for right of way improvements to Supervisor-Electric Distribution Forestry. Responds to customer inquiries and complaints and attends customer-initiated meetings (i.e. Home Owners Associations). Provides assistance to customers regarding electric distribution forestry matters and maintains contact with Local, State, and Federal agencies. Reviews contractor documentation related to safety and billing to ensure accuracy, and approves billing documents. Safely operates vehicles suitable for inspecting rights of way, both on-road and off-road. Facilitates an intradepartmental weekly safety call, as requested by supervisor. Responds to service restoration activities as needed. Works toward successful completion of the Dominion Forestry Training Program, Virginia or North Carolina Herbicide Applicator's License and the International Society of Arboriculture Arborist certification.
